Charles-Antoine Coypel was a French painter, Premier Painter to the King and director of the Royal Academy in the eighteenth century. He developed an elegant, theatrical manner that fused precise drawing, refined colour and staged composition, informed by his engagement with theatre and literature. His works—whether grand court portraits, tapestry cartoons for the Gobelins (notably on Don Quixote), or stage designs—are distinguished by narrative richness, sumptuous fabrics and controlled light.
